FAQs About Fusion 360 vs AutoCAD

Fusion 360 and AutoCAD serve distinct purposes in the design world. Fusion 360 excels in 3D modeling, offering integrated CAD, CAM, and CAE tools, making it ideal for product design and engineering. AutoCAD, on the other hand, is a versatile 2D drafting tool, widely used in architecture and engineering for precise technical drawings. Choosing between them depends on project needs: Fusion 360 for complex 3D projects and AutoCAD for detailed 2D plans. Both are powerful, but their applications differ significantly.
